Portugal Breaks Record With Largest Programming Lesson Ever

On October 12, 2024, nearly 1,700 students of varying ages gathered at the University of Lisbon’s IST school of technology to set a new Guinness World Record for the largest computer programming lesson in a single venue. This event aimed to highlight Portugal’s growing status as a hub for information technology and to promote computing literacy among the public.

The event took place at the prestigious University of Lisbon, where students gathered to engage in a massive programming lesson. The atmosphere was electric, filled with excitement and anticipation as participants prepared to break the previous record set in 2016.

Portugal has been increasingly recognized as a burgeoning center for technology and innovation. Events like this not only showcase the country’s capabilities but also attract international attention to its educational institutions and tech industry.
